The Role

Join our collaborative team as a Senior Site Specialist within Unity Lab Services. Working directly at our customer's laboratory in Milton Park, Oxfordshire, you will play a critical role in supporting researchers and scientists by delivering high-quality laboratory support services.

You will be responsible for ensuring the smooth day-to-day operation of laboratory services, including inventory management, laboratory logistics, equipment coordination, and customer support. This role is ideal for someone who enjoys working in a dynamic laboratory environment while providing exceptional service and operational excellence.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ide day-to-day laboratory support to ensure uninterrupted scientific operations.
  • Manage laboratory inventory, stock replenishment, and materials management.
  • Coordinate laboratory logistics and equipment maintenance activities.
  • Deliver outstanding customer service while building strong relationships with laboratory staff.
  • Support laboratory safety and compliance by following GMP/GLP standards and site procedures.
  • Maintain accurate documentation and inventory records using laboratory management systems.
  • Handle chemical inventory and waste management processes where required.
  • Collaborate with researchers, scientists, and internal Thermo Fisher teams to continuously improve service delivery.

Requirements

  • Minimum 2 years of experience in a laboratory environment and/or customer service role.
  • Degree or background in Biology, Chemistry, or a related scientific discipline preferred.
  • Strong proficiency in Microsoft Office, particularly Excel.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
  • Experience using inventory management systems and handheld scanners.
  • Knowledge of GMP/GLP environments and laboratory safety procedures is preferred.
  • Strong analytical, organisational, and problem-solving skills.
  • Ability to work independently while maintaining exceptional attention to detail.
  • Customer-focused mindset with a professional and collaborative approach.
  • Ability to lift, push, and pull 30–40 lbs (14–18 kg) regularly and up to 50 lbs (23 kg) occasionally.
  • Ability to stand and walk for extended periods and work in varying laboratory environments.
  • Willingness to wear required PPE, including laboratory coats, safety glasses, and safety footwear.
  • Flexibility to work overtime when required.
  • Valid driving licence may be required for certain activities.
  • IATA/DOT certification and bilingual language skills are considered advantageous.
  • Experience operating material handling equipment (such as pallet jacks and pushcarts) is beneficial.
